This is a key post in enabling SBUHB to deliver pathways for paediatric dentistry serving the Health Boards' population.
The post holder will be professionally responsible to the Associate Medical Director for Dentistry SBUHB but line managed through the CDS Clinical Lead. The candidate will need to be on the GDC specialist list for paediatric dentistry.
Main duties of the job
The post holder will lead, develop and deliver paediatric services based in the Community including screening of children referred into primary and secondary care based GA services.
The successful candidate will be expected to contribute to clinical audit in line with the Health Board's policy, to participate in the teaching of various groups and to undertake any associated administrative duties associated with the care of patients seen within the service.
Applicants should possess excellent communication skills and the ability to make independent clinical decisions. The successful candidate will need to have:
- Experience of providing treatment for children and adolescents under inhalation sedation
- Experience of providing treatment for children under general anaesthesia
- Experience of treatment planning children for exodontia and restorative care under general anaesthesia
Travel between hospital/clinic sites will be required to undertake duties.

Person Specification
Education and Qualifications
Essential
- Full GDC registration
- GDC specialist list for Paediatric Dentistry
Desirable
- Further qualifications e.g. MFDS
Experience and Knowledge
Essential
- Experience of treatment planning and providing comprehensive treatment for children and adolescents under conscious sedation and general anaesthesia including those with complex medical histories or requiring joint working with other specialties.
Skills and Abilities
Essential
- Commitment to multi-disciplinary working
- Understanding of clinical risk management and clinical governance
- Up to date with current practices in paediatric dentistry
- Ability to take independent clinical decisions when necessary and to seek advice from senior doctors as appropriate
- Evidence of involvement in audit
Desirable
- Evidence of involvement in teaching undergraduate dental students and DCPs
- Research interests relevant to speciality
- Teaching Experience
- Efficient administration
Personal Attributes
Essential
- Effective communication skills - verbal and written
- Ability to be flexible
- Motivated and efficient
- Evidence of ability to work within a team and alone
- Willingness to participate in annual appraisal process

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).
From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
